Chinese cities are rolling out optimized COVID-19 measures to balance public health and economic recovery, with residents and expats alike celebrating the return of hassle-free travel. From high-speed rail adventures to revived night markets, the phased easing aims to minimize disruptions while keeping communities safe.
Pakistani vlogger Younus Ghazali, who’s called Kunming home for six years, shared his post-restriction train journey in a viral video. “People here are thrilled—they feel the past policies kept everyone secure, and now there’s new energy,” he said. Having explored the Chinese mainland extensively during the pandemic, Ghazali highlights locals’ optimism as daily life regains momentum.
The changes reflect what officials call a “people-first” strategy: protecting livelihoods while reigniting social and economic growth. Analysts say this shift could set a blueprint for sustainable post-pandemic recovery—no lockdowns required.
